Understanding Plumbing Costs in Scranton
Water heater installation costs in Scranton average $1,365.73, reflecting the city's cost of living that runs 6.4% below the national average. This lower regional price parity of 93.6 contributes to reduced labor and service costs compared to national benchmarks, allowing Scranton plumbers to offer competitive pricing while maintaining profitability. The local plumbing market in Scranton includes multiple service providers competing for residential work, which helps maintain pricing within the $545.10 to $3,177.13 range depending on equipment complexity and installation requirements. Scranton's older housing stock and established infrastructure also influence installation costs, as many homes require standard replacements rather than complex retrofitting, keeping typical jobs toward the lower-to-middle end of the service spectrum.
